About the role
A Job Developer assists individuals with disabilities throughout the job search process and helps them find a job that fits their goals.

DESCRIPTION
You help individuals write their resume, make connections in their community, apply for positions, interview, and get the jobs they want. In the process, you focus on building relationships, creating opportunities, and helping people find a fulfilling career. Imagine hearing this:

As a Job Developer, you provide tools for the individuals we serve to complete the job search process and secure their dream job.
REQUIREMENTS
- High school diploma/GED or above.
- Ability to type 25 words per minute and navigate a company-issued laptop.
- A clean driving record and willingness to transport clients in company vehicles.
- Ability to pass a background and drug screening (a list of the disqualifying offenses can be provided if needed).
